Alternative medicine
By Mayo Clinic staffThere's little evidence that alternative medicine treatments work for tinnitus. However, some alternative therapies that have been tried for tinnitus include:
- Acupuncture
- Hypnosis
- The herb ginkgo
- Zinc supplements
- Lipoflavonoid, a vitamin complex supplement
